History & Mission

Founded in 2001 by a group of volunteers andcommunity leaders, Hamline Midway Elders is one of 31 block nurse programs in Minnesota.  As a neighborhood based organization, we provide services which help seniors live in their own homes for as long as possible, delaying or avoiding completely, the need for expensive, taxpayer subsidized nursing home placement. 
 
Primary Goals
 

  • Assist seniors with at least one activity of daily living.  We arrange transportation, meal & grocery delivery, shopping, seasonal chore assistance, telephone reassurance, friendly visits, volunteer respite, caregiver support referrals for counseling and caregiver support, minor home repairs & modifications, or arrange appropriate nursing and home health aide care. According to our data base, the number of seniors we served each year continues to hover around 185 with 60-70 new persons served added each year. 
  • Recruit, train and manage neighborhood residents to be volunteers so they are able to assist with the above listed activities, as well as support for our educational and social events.   From January to December 2007, we enlisted the help of 125 volunteers, 28 of whom were new to the organization.
